+use MediaWiki\Services\SalvageableService;
+use Wikimedia\Assert\Assert;
+
+/**
+ * Factory class to create Config objects
+ *
+ * @since 1.23
+ */
+class ConfigFactory implements SalvageableService {
+
+       /**
+        * Map of config name => callback
+        * @var array
+        */
+       protected $factoryFunctions = [];
+
+       /**
+        * Config objects that have already been created
+        * name => Config object
+        * @var array
+        */
+       protected $configs = [];
+
+       /**
+        * @deprecated since 1.27, use MediaWikiServices::getConfigFactory() instead.
+        *
+        * @return ConfigFactory
+        */
+       public static function getDefaultInstance() {
+               return \MediaWiki\MediaWikiServices::getInstance()->getConfigFactory();
+       }
+
+       /**
+        * Re-uses existing Cache objects from $other. Cache objects are only re-used if the
+        * registered factory function for both is the same. Cache config is not copied,
+        * and only instances of caches defined on this instance with the same config
+        * are copied.
+        *
+        * @see SalvageableService::salvage()
+        *
+        * @param SalvageableService $other The object to salvage state from. $other must have the
+        * exact same type as $this.
+        */
+       public function salvage( SalvageableService $other ) {
+               Assert::parameterType( self::class, $other, '$other' );
+
+               /** @var ConfigFactory $other */
+               foreach ( $other->factoryFunctions as $name => $otherFunc ) {
+                       if ( !isset( $this->factoryFunctions[$name] ) ) {
+                               continue;
+                       }
+
+                       // if the callback function is the same, salvage the Cache object
+                       // XXX: Closures are never equal!
+                       if ( isset( $other->configs[$name] )
+                               && $this->factoryFunctions[$name] == $otherFunc
+                       ) {
+                               $this->configs[$name] = $other->configs[$name];
+                               unset( $other->configs[$name] );
+                       }
+               }
+
+               // disable $other
+               $other->factoryFunctions = [];
+               $other->configs = [];
+       }
+
+       /**
+        * @return string[]
+        */
+       public function getConfigNames() {
+               return array_keys( $this->factoryFunctions );
+       }
+
+       /**
+        * Register a new config factory function.
+        * Will override if it's already registered.
+        * Use "*" for $name to provide a fallback config for all unknown names.
+        * @param string $name
+        * @param callable|Config $callback A factory callabck that takes this ConfigFactory
+        *        as an argument and returns a Config instance, or an existing Config instance.
+        * @throws InvalidArgumentException If an invalid callback is provided
+        */
+       public function register( $name, $callback ) {
+               if ( !is_callable( $callback ) && !( $callback instanceof Config ) ) {
+                       throw new InvalidArgumentException( 'Invalid callback provided' );
+               }
+
+               unset( $this->configs[$name] );
+               $this->factoryFunctions[$name] = $callback;
+       }
+
+       /**
+        * Create a given Config using the registered callback for $name.
+        * If an object was already created, the same Config object is returned.
+        * @param string $name Name of the extension/component you want a Config object for
+        *                     'main' is used for core
+        * @throws ConfigException If a factory function isn't registered for $name
+        * @throws UnexpectedValueException If the factory function returns a non-Config object
+        * @return Config
+        */
+       public function makeConfig( $name ) {
+               if ( !isset( $this->configs[$name] ) ) {
+                       $key = $name;
+                       if ( !isset( $this->factoryFunctions[$key] ) ) {
+                               $key = '*';
+                       }
+                       if ( !isset( $this->factoryFunctions[$key] ) ) {
+                               throw new ConfigException( "No registered builder available for $name." );
+                       }
+
+                       if ( $this->factoryFunctions[$key] instanceof Config ) {
+                               $conf = $this->factoryFunctions[$key];
+                       } else {
+                               $conf = call_user_func( $this->factoryFunctions[$key], $this );
+                       }
+
+                       if ( $conf instanceof Config ) {
+                               $this->configs[$name] = $conf;
+                       } else {
+                               throw new UnexpectedValueException( "The builder for $name returned a non-Config object." );
+                       }
+               }
+
+               return $this->configs[$name];
+       }
+
+}
